Miami Regional vs. South Georgia State

Miami Regional ranked #-1 and South Georgia State ranked #-1 in national university ranking. The following statements compare Miami Regional University and South Georgia State College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Miami Regional's tuition ($36,366) is more expensive than South Georgia State ($9,322).
  • South Georgia State's students to faculty ratio (19 to 1) is lower than Miami Regional (26 to 1).
  • South Georgia State (1,853 students) is larger than Miami Regional (955 students) with more enrolled students.
  • South Georgia State ($5,941) has higher amount of financial aid than Miami Regional ($4,155).
  • Miami Regional's graduation rate (21%) is higher than South Georgia State (20%).
